    I had a very uncomfortable experience at Fat Daddy's Barbecue today, and I feel obligated to share…read moreit so no one else gets hurt the way I did. While sitting on one of the wooden bench seats and placing my order with my husband, I suddenly felt something stab into the back of my left thigh. The pain was immediate and intense. When I reached back, I realized a piece of the bench had broken off and gone inside my skin. I was wearing a dress, so I jumped up in a panic trying to get it out. My husband couldn't see it at first because it was embedded inside my leg. After several attempts, we finally managed to pull it out -- and the piece of wood had blood on it. I now have a painful welt on my thigh, and as a diabetic, this kind of injury is especially concerning because of the risk of infection. I'm also concerned about what germs or bacteria were in that wood. I showed the piece of the bench to the waitress (it was her first day, and she clearly didn't know what to do), and I asked her to let the manager know because I didn't want anyone else to experience this. No one came to check on me. No one asked if I was okay. My husband eventually had to ask for our food to-go because I was so shaken and miserable I couldn't even stay to eat. When I went to the counter and asked for the manager myself, she came out and gave a very dismissive "I'm sorry about that, I'll check it out." I followed her to show her the bench, and her response was, "Yeah, I see. I'll just have them turn the bench to the other side." That was it. No concern, no incident report, no offer to help, no acknowledgment of how serious this was -- after we spent $88 on our meals. This experience completely ruined my day, left me injured, and left me extremely disappointed in the lack of care or responsibility shown by management. I truly hope they fix this issue before someone else gets hurt.

    Fat Daddy's BBQ My wife and I drive past this place all the…read moretime on our way to my mom's house. Usually it's later in the evening when they're already closed, or it's Monday-Wednesday when they're not open when we're heading back home. This time it was around 7:00, we were driving by, and I thought, "Let's stop in and grab some dinner and try something new." The first thing we noticed getting out of the car was the smell outside, which honestly wasn't very pleasant. Across the street there are several chicken barns, so I'm assuming that may have been part of it. When we walked in, we were greeted right away and told to sit wherever we liked. Inside is very nicely decorated. There's a counter with a few seats, several two- and four-top tables, and through a small hallway there are larger tables that I'm guessing become communal seating when it gets busy. Our server, Jaylin, came over quickly to take our drink order. He explained the beer options and mentioned they had homemade lemonade and sweet tea. My wife asked for unsweet tea but they only offer sweet tea, so she ended up getting water. I ordered the sweet tea and they definitely weren't kidding -- it's sweet! For dinner we ordered the three-meat plate with brisket and pit beef, along with collard greens and coleslaw. The food came out looking good, and I actually took a picture, but of course now I can't find it on my phone. The one disappointing thing was the brisket presentation. Instead of sliced brisket, it came out looking more like a pile of shredded beef. The meat itself was tender and flavorful, and some pieces had a nice bark on them. The pit beef was also tender and served warm, although I was expecting more traditional sliced beef. The collard greens were very good. I asked for some cider vinegar for them and was initially told they didn't have any. A few minutes later, a gentleman walked by and asked how everything was. I mentioned the vinegar situation and he immediately said they had gallons of it and brought some over, which I appreciated. The coleslaw just wasn't my style. I prefer shredded cabbage slaw, while theirs was chopped. It wasn't bad -- we still finished it -- just not my personal preference. I noticed another table got cornbread that looked really good, so I ordered a piece. Unfortunately, that was another small disappointment. It looked good on the outside, but once I cut into it, it was very dense and seemed to be mostly cornmeal without any actual corn in it. After taking a bite, it also seemed like it may have been microwaved because the inside had a rubbery texture. Overall, the meats were good and the sides were solid. One thing to note: make sure you read the ENTIRE menu carefully. There is a $5 upcharge for double meat. Yes, it's printed in red, but I completely overlooked it. Personally, I don't think the extra meat was worth the additional charge, and had I noticed it beforehand I probably would have ordered something different. It would have been nice if the server had casually mentioned the upcharge when ordering. Honestly, he probably would have gotten a better tip. They also offer homemade desserts, which I'll definitely try next time. Another table ordered the bread pudding and it looked amazing. One last thing: I understand we were there close to closing time, but while we were still eating, Jaylin started sweeping the rugs at the entrance inside the restaurant and rolling them up. That's probably something that should either be done outside or after the last customers leave. Overall, we enjoyed our visit and definitely look forward to stopping in again whenever we come through while they're open.
